Dr. Sweety Agarwal is a dedicated engineering educator whose work centers on enhancing quality control education through innovative, technology-driven laboratory modules. Her primary research area involves the development of e-quality laboratory modules, which bridge theoretical concepts in engineering quality control with practical, hands-on learning experiences. Her most cited paper, "Development of E-Quality Laboratory Modules for Use in Engineering Quality Control Courses" (2020), has garnered 6 citations, reflecting its growing influence among educators seeking to modernize curriculum delivery. This work, supported by an NSF CCLI grant, demonstrates her commitment to improving pedagogical outcomes by integrating digital tools into traditional lab settings.
